Tips for Staying Safe While Skiing Off-Piste
Skiing off-piste can be an exhilarating experience for those who seek adventure on the slopes. However, it also comes with its own set of risks and challenges that must be taken seriously. One of the most important aspects of skiing off-piste is being prepared for the conditions you may encounter, including the possibility of avalanches. In addition to using calcio para la nieve, there are other safety measures you can take while skiing off-piste to reduce the risk of accidents. Always check the weather and avalanche conditions before heading out, and be prepared to change your plans if conditions are unfavorable. It is also important to ski with a partner or group, so you can watch out for each other and provide assistance in case of an emergency.
When skiing off-piste, it is crucial to stay within your skill level and avoid taking unnecessary risks. Be aware of your surroundings and pay attention to signs of potential avalanches, such as recent snowfall, wind patterns, and changes in temperature. If you are unsure about the safety of a particular slope, it is better to err on the side of caution and choose a different route.
In the event of an avalanche, knowing how to react quickly and effectively can make all the difference. If you are caught in an avalanche, try to ski to the side of the slide path or grab onto a tree or rock to avoid being swept away. If you are buried by snow, try to create an air pocket around your face and mouth to help you breathe while waiting for rescue.

Q&A
1. ¿Qué es el calcio para la nieve?
– El calcio para la nieve es un compuesto químico que se utiliza para derretir la nieve y el hielo en las carreteras y aceras.
2. ¿Cómo funciona el calcio para la nieve?
– El calcio para la nieve funciona al absorber la humedad del hielo y la nieve, lo que reduce su punto de congelación y ayuda a derretirlo más rápidamente.
3. ¿Es el calcio para la nieve seguro para el medio ambiente?
– Aunque el calcio para la nieve es efectivo para derretir el hielo, puede ser perjudicial para el medio ambiente si se usa en grandes cantidades, ya que puede contaminar el agua y dañar la vegetación. Se recomienda utilizarlo con moderación y seguir las instrucciones de uso.
